Bugzilla – Bug 1214182
Problem with starting amavis after update of Tumbleweed to 20230809
Last modified: 2023-08-14 19:26:56 UTC
After the latest update of Tumbleweed starting service amavis fails with the message: aug 11 10:24:02 eiktum systemd[1]: Starting Amavisd-new Virus Scanner interface... aug 11 10:24:02 eiktum amavis[7902]: Starting virus-scanner (amavisd-new): aug 11 10:24:02 eiktum amavis[7903]: Can't locate Amavis/Boot.pm in @INC (you may need to install the Amavis::Boot module) (@INC ent ries checked: /usr/lib/perl5/site_perl/5.38.0/x86_64-linux-thread-multi /usr/lib/perl5/site_perl/5.38.0 /usr/lib/perl5/vendor_perl/5 .38.0/x86_64-linux-thread-multi /usr/lib/perl5/vendor_perl/5.38.0 /usr/lib/perl5/5.38.0/x86_64-linux-thread-multi /usr/lib/perl5/5.3 8.0 /usr/lib/perl5/site_perl) at /usr/sbin/amavisd line 99. aug 11 10:24:02 eiktum systemd[1]: amavis.service: Main process exited, code=exited, status=1/FAILURE aug 11 10:24:02 eiktum systemd[1]: amavis.service: Failed with result 'exit-code'. aug 11 10:24:02 eiktum systemd[1]: Failed to start Amavisd-new Virus Scanner interface. I found the module Amavis/Boot.pm in /usr/lib/perl5/site_perl/5.36.0/ but a symbolic link in /usr/lib/perl5/site_perl/5.38.0 to Amavis in /usr/lib/perl5/site_perl/5.36.0/ did not solve the problem.
I requested a rebuild for amavisd-new yesterday and a new build will be available in snapshot 0812 which will fix this for now. A permanent solution to prevent this from recurring in the future is in https://build.opensuse.org/request/show/1103583 and is already in Staging.
Fixed in snapshot 0812